Description of the Drug

Mirtazapine is a tetracyclic antidepressant used in the treatment of major depression and is used off-label as a drug for insomnia and to increase appetite.

Mechanism(s) Of Action

Target Name Target Type Action Type Target ChEMBL ID
Adrenergic receptor alpha-2 PROTEIN FAMILY ANTAGONIST CHEMBL2095158
Serotonin 2a (5-HT2a) receptor SINGLE PROTEIN ANTAGONIST CHEMBL224
Serotonin 2c (5-HT2c) receptor SINGLE PROTEIN ANTAGONIST CHEMBL225
